Rengeō-in (Sanjūsangen-dō) Temple

Rengeō-in (Sanjūsangen-dō) Temple

Place Of Worship
Place of worship
star
4.6

Marvel at 1,001 golden statues of Kannon, lined up in Japan’s longest wooden building. The sheer scale and intricate details are awe-inspiring. Allow ample time to appreciate the artistry and spiritual ambiance.

Daishoin

Daishoin

Place Of Worship
Place of worship
star
4.5

Explore this temple featuring 500 rakan statues adorned with knitted caps, a mystical lantern-lit cave, and spinning prayer wheels. The unique statues and serene atmosphere offer a profound cultural experience. Don't miss the panoramic views from the upper levels.

Katsuoji

Katsuoji

Place Of Worship
Place of worship
star
4.4

Discover the 'daruma doll temple,' where thousands of red figures are tucked into every corner. Each doll represents a wish or goal, creating a truly unique and inspiring atmosphere. A must-see for its cultural significance.
